Sarasa

Uttar Pradesh — Chunar, Mirzapur • Rural
Sarasa is a rural settlement in Chunar, Mirzapur, Uttar Pradesh. It has a population of 866 in about 130 households (avg size: 6.66). Approximate literacy: 53.46%.

Population of Sarasa

Population (Total)866
Male460
Female406
Children (0–6 years)134
Households130
Literate persons463
Illiterate persons403
Total workers239
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)883
Literacy (approx.)53.46%
SC population23
ST population0
